A farce, in two acts by Frederick Fox Cooper. Full title The Spare Bed, or The Shower Bath. Performed at the Victoria Theatre, 8 July 1833.

Performance history in South Africa

1853: Performed by the Port Elizabeth Amateurs in the "new Theatre" on 22 October , with selections from Henry V and An Unwarrantable Intrusion (Morton).
